Target Specialty Products announced it plans for the GCSAA Conference and Trade Show. Scheduled for Feb. 4-5 in San Diego, the event presents an opportunity for industry professionals to engage with Target Specialty Products at booth #4845, where they can explore advancements in golf course management and the turf and ornamental market.
